Michael and Linda Molina from the Emerging Sciences Foundation hosted a live interview with Morgan O. Smith to discuss the process of spiritual awakening.

Morgan O. Smith is a revered meditation instructor and spiritual guide. His life took a transformative turn in 2008, leading him to commit wholeheartedly to assisting others in discovering their inner tranquility. This led to the establishment of Yinnergy Meditation, a grassroots movement that utilizes the potency of audio-guided deep meditation practices to foster emotional, mental, and spiritual growth.

He has penned the newly released book, “Bodhi in the Brain”, which delves deeply into the symbiotic relationship between meditation and neuroscience. He has collaborated with the Institute of Noetic Sciences (IONS), and presented at the Institute for Consciousness Research’s 37th Annual Conference. He has also appeared on podcasts such as “Guru Viking” and “Waking the Wild.”

He used to be a comedy writer, stand-up comedian and an acclaimed television personality. He co-hosted the award-winning show, “Buzz” and shared the stage with comedy legends and featured in nearly 50 television shows, indie films, and documentaries. His insights influenced Arian Herbert’s compelling book, “The God Behind The God.”

Morgan’s unique journey from entertainment to the tranquil realm of mindfulness enables him to resonate with diverse audiences and guide them toward a life enriched with inner peace.
